Just the other day, unusual images similar to logos began to catch the eye on the web. In them, the theme of dismemberment of bodies is played out in every possible way, and they are united by a common St. Petersburg theme and an unusual "toponym" - Dismemberment. The hashtag #dismemberment unites these works, among which there are many very professional ones. Where did this creepy phenomenon come from and what is it related to?

As it turned out, there is nothing mystical in the logos of Dismemberment. Illustrations with bloody plots and painfully familiar St. Petersburg silhouettes are works for a competition announced in groups and telegram channels by the famous journalist, publicist and producer Alexander Glebovich Nevzorov, known for his caustic satire on what is happening in Events in Russia and the world.

As we can see, Alexander Glebovich is looking for talents and is going to give the world a new, extraordinary and, of course, hysterical brand of hurrah-patriots. Judging by the posts in Facebook and Instagram groups, there is no end to those who want to take a designer's vacancy, and the admins' personal accounts and directs are bursting with work.

We have thoroughly searched the expanses of the Runet and collected several logos and sketches that, without any doubt, deserve the attention of our readers. We hope that the authors and Alexander Glebovich himself will not be offended with us for this publication.

Where did such an unexpected idea come from? Most likely, it was not without an incident that less than a year ago shocked everyone with its cruelty and senselessness.

In early November 2019, the historian, associate professor of St. Petersburg State University Oleg Sokolov, killed his student lover in a fit of jealousy, dismembered her body and tried to drown her body parts in the Sink.
